package javax.lang.model.element;

import java.util.List;

import javax.lang.model.type.TypeMirror;

/**
 * Represents a method, constructor or initialiser (static
 * or instance) for a class or interface (including annotation
 * types).
 *
 * @author Andrew John Hughes (gnu_andrew@member.fsf.org)
 * @since 1.6
 * @see javax.lang.model.type.ExecutableType
 */
public interface ExecutableElement
  extends Element
{

  /**
   * Returns the default value of this type if this is an
   * annotation with a default, or {@code null} otherwise.
   *
   * @return the default value or {@code null}.
   */
  AnnotationValue getDefaultValue();

  /**
   * Returns the formal parameters of this executable
   * in the order they were declared.  If there are no
   * parameters, the list is empty.
   *
   * @return the formal parameters.
   */
  List<? extends VariableElement> getParameters();

  /**
   * Returns the return type of this executable or
   * an instance of {@link javax.lang.model.type.NoType}
   * with the kind {@link javax.lang.model.type.TypeKind#VOID}
   * if there is no return type or this is a
   * constructor or initialiser.
   *
   * @return the return type of the executbale.
   */
  TypeMirror getReturnType();

  /**
   * Returns the exceptions or other throwables listed
   * in the {@code throws} clause in the order they
   * are declared.  The list is empty if there is no
   * {@code throws} clause.
   *
   * @return the exceptions or other throwables listed
   *         as thrown by this executable.
   */
  List<? extends TypeMirror> getThrownTypes();

  /**
   * Returns the formal type parameters of this executable
   * in the order they were declared.  The list is empty
   * if there are no type parameters.
   *
   * @return the formal type parameters.
   */
  List<? extends TypeParameterElement> getTypeParameters();

  /**
   * Returns {@code true} if this method or constructor accepts
   * a variable number of arguments.
   *
   * @return true if this is a varargs method or constructor.
   */
  boolean isVarArgs();

}
